Output 908766b97ee22c38da661f14474690a7010d1aa50ff6e3434caffa356721620a:5

value
182537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3211ea9776bce26a8ad4f256ecaa617013116fef OP_EQUAL
address
36FmAzBeUYKBCiihUmc4KHTg3QVz6EHViy
transaction
908766b97ee22c38da661f14474690a7010d1aa50ff6e3434caffa356721620a
spent
true